There are so many jumps between 15-year-old Jo, 22-year-old Jo, and many ages in between, often with only a minute or two in each scene and sometimes with scarce cues in lighting or character age to differentiate the two &#8212; I&#8217;m thinking in particular of the sequence covering Beth&#8217;s illness and eventual death. But the jumps, while sometimes confusing, do still enhance the emotional impact of such scenes, so I can&#8217;t fault director Greta Gerwig too much.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Beyond that, I loved everything about this movie! The cozy family scenes are just as heartwarming as you&#8217;d want them to be &#8212; the cinematography and costuming are lush and gorgeous &#8212; the actresses are all believable in bringing to life the author&#8217;s intention.
